Stroke in Fabry Disease

Fabry disease (FD), also known as angiokeratoma corporis diffusum , is an X-linked lysosomal storage disorder caused by deficiency of α-galactosidase A (α-gal). This defect causes the accumulation of glycosphingolipids in cells, including endothelial and vascular smooth muscle cells of…
